Hong Leong selling OEM bellypan for FZ1, was quoted around ~700 SGD. Madness.. But frankly speaking, Yamaha OEM belly pan is one of the best looking belly pan for FZ1.

However one guy managed to get it for around 500+ SGD, what he told me was that was the last piece, and non-matching colour at HL at that time when he purchased it.

I saw a authorized Yamaha dealer @ UK selling at a very low pricing, £209.99 = around ~ 450 SGD excluding shipping.
